Job Duties

  • Managing and executing multi-channel projects that include live experiential events, video/content production and social and digital driven initiatives
  • Developing a detailed plan of action leading it through completion and ensuring that the project is running smoothly during all phases
  • Working cross-functionally (internally and externally) to ensure all deliverables and deadlines are identified and managed day-to-day in order to successfully meet expectations and project goals
  • Managing production staff, including assigning individual responsibilities and setting deadlines and deliverables
  • Translating creative ideas into project plans and deliverables
  • Ensuring that integrated event solutions are innovative and strategically relevant, building brand equity and delivering results for the client
  • Overseeing the creation and maintenance of critical project tracking and documentation
  • Developing and managing budgets, handling vendor contract and fee negotiations, ensuring billing and invoicing terms and processes are met
  • Managing onsite teams to ensure the seamless installation and execution
  • Ability to travel as we produce projects and events across the country
  • In tandem with the Project Manager, ensuring client priorities and objectives are met and maintained throughout the production/execution
  • Leading clear and consistent communication and coordination between internal team members, clients and suppliers
  • Understanding and clearly translating both team and client vision, direction, and needs to 3rd party suppliers
  • Managing client needs and expectations, while building and strengthening client relationships through superior execution
  • Assisting with the development and refining of Statements of Work, Purchase Orders and Vendor Agreements
